    No and Yes. had the inspection and CRC spray in ~Dec 2017. Toyota dealer couldn't do it so they outsourced it to a local shop. Stuff was falling off a year later, brought it in, found a hole and got a frame swap ~Feb 2019. Been using Fluid Film on the new frame.

    well, nothing to see really, some new frame plugs and a little white splooge dripping out here and there, it is not black tarry goop, it looks more like lithium grease what they sprayed inside the front box parts of frame, the outside of frame and exposed open rear sections are untouched.
